In addition to coming from an unnatural position — straight at your subject —direct flash tends to wash out skin tones.
Professor Kobré calls this the police mug shot look. He gives an F to pictures like these.
|
|
By redirecting the light from your pop up flash toward a light-colored ceiling or wall with Professor Kobré’s Lightscoop, you can create a professional-quality portrait.
The diffused light produces more natural-looking skin tones. Here, the light was bounced off a wall. Light coming from the side emulates dramatic window light. These pictures have NOT been retouched!
HINT: No light-colored wall? Bounce off a piece of white cardboard, white fabric, or other neutral, light-colored surface.

Professor Kobré’s Lightscoop changes the direction
of the tiny light coming from the pop up flash in your Canon, Pentax, or
Nikon camera.
- The bounced light creates an
effectively larger light source.
- The larger source sends out light from a more
natural direction.
- The auto function of your pop up flash continues
to operate
normally, so the flash properly
exposes the picture.
